Crypto and Blockchain Noticed the Most Funding in Portuguese Fintech Market in 2022


The Portuguese fintech sector is turning into related on the world scale uncovers the Portugal Fintech Affiliation in its 2022 version of the the Portugal Fintech Report.

Alongside this constructive information, the fintech affiliation introduced the launch of the Portugal Fintech Scholarship, a scholarship for brand new startups that ensures help for six months at the Fintech Home, in hopes of maintaining this progress.

The Portugal Fintech Report yearly distinguishes the Portuguese fintechs that stood out in the nationwide and worldwide panorama. The fintech ecosystem is rising, grounded on the increasing blockchain and crypto startups that characterizeed round 75 per cent of all funds raised in fintech in Portugal.

In 2021, the highest fintech startups in Portugal raised greater than €437million in funding, with the best funding sectors being in cybersecurity and regtech, blockchain, cryptocurrency, and insurance coverage.

A yr later, the market has modified as payments, and lending and credit score are the 2 predominant verticals representing round 39 per cent of startups. Nevertheless, blockchain and crypto proceed to develop steadily and already characterize 17 per cent of the ecosystem. 

In 2022, the Portuguese fintech market is estimated to have raised over €1billion, over double that of 2021, additional emphasising its progress.

The report consists of a wide range of content material produced by fintech specialists, similar to Diogo Mónica, president of the first crypto Portuguese unicorn, Anchorage or Eva Ruiz, southern Europe head of fintech for VISA.

The Portuguese fintech ecosystem confirmed sturdy traits of resiliency throughout 2022. In a yr of uncertainty and rivalry, Portuguese startups closed a number of rounds and rising whole funding for the interval. As a vacation spot Portugal continues to obtain an inflow of l. a.rger startups that open their workplaces to reap the benefits of the expertise pool but additionally from the sense of neighborhood”, explains João Freire de Andrade, founding father of Portugal Fintech.

The report consists of two unique sections on collaboration between startups and mature gamers, but additionally a chapter on the crypto ecosystem and the way can mature gamers discover crypto associated alternatives.

Along with offering related knowledge on expertise, capital, funding, and regulation within the sector, the report explores why Portugal is rising as a startup hub, with insights from IDC stating that Portugal’s specialised expertise is a predominant driver, in addition to the truth that it has been the host for Net Summit since 2016 and its worldwide by design setting boosted by the necessity from startups to deal with worldwide markets from an earlystage.

The report is supported by a number of companions, together with VISA, Morais Leitão and KPMG, who clarify the significance of the connection with fintechs for the event of innovation within the monetary business.
